About Permanent Residency Law in Santa Barbara, United States

Permanent Residency, also known as a Green Card, allows individuals to live and work permanently in the United States. In Santa Barbara, California, the process of obtaining Permanent Residency can be complex and may require the assistance of a legal expert. Frequently Asked Questions

1. What are the eligibility criteria for Permanent Residency in Santa Barbara?

Eligibility criteria for Permanent Residency in Santa Barbara include having a qualifying family relationship, employment offer, or other special circumstances. It is recommended to consult with a legal expert to determine your eligibility.

2. How long does the Permanent Residency application process take in Santa Barbara?

The processing time for Permanent Residency applications in Santa Barbara can vary depending on the individual's circumstances. On average, it can take several months to several years to complete the process.

3. Can I work in Santa Barbara with a Green Card?

Yes, once you have obtained Permanent Residency in Santa Barbara, you are allowed to work and live in the United States permanently.

4. What are the benefits of Permanent Residency in Santa Barbara?

Some of the benefits of Permanent Residency in Santa Barbara include the ability to live and work in the United States indefinitely, access to education and healthcare benefits, and the opportunity to apply for U.S. citizenship.

5. Can I apply for Permanent Residency if I am currently in Santa Barbara on a different visa?

Yes, it is possible to apply for Permanent Residency in Santa Barbara while on a different visa. However, the process may vary depending on the type of visa you hold.

6. What happens if my Permanent Residency application is denied?

If your Permanent Residency application is denied in Santa Barbara, you may have the option to appeal the decision or reapply. It is important to seek legal advice in such situations to explore your options.

7. Can I sponsor family members for Permanent Residency in Santa Barbara?

Yes, as a Permanent Resident in Santa Barbara, you may be eligible to sponsor certain family members for Permanent Residency. The specific requirements and process may vary, so it is advisable to consult with a legal expert.

8. Are there any restrictions on Permanent Residents in Santa Barbara?

While Permanent Residents in Santa Barbara have the right to live and work in the United States indefinitely, there may be certain restrictions on travel outside of the country for extended periods. It is important to understand these restrictions before making travel plans.
